Job Summary

We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Support Professional to join our team at the Developmental Disabilities Institute. As a Support Professional, you will play a vital role in supporting individuals with Autism and developmental disabilities in their daily lives.

Responsibilities
  • Complete all required trainings and participate in Peer Mentoring Program, in-service workshops, and recertification trainings as required.
  • Become certified and maintain certifications in SCIP-R, First Aid, and CPR.
  • Must have a Valid NYS Driver's license and be able to obtain DDI approved driver status.
  • Participate in semi-annual IDT, quarterly staff meetings, and staffing as required.
  • Advocate for the rights of the individuals we serve.
  • Help individuals build relationships and maintain relationships with family and friends.
  • Follow individual daily activity/classroom schedule, implementing all formal goals and protocols of individuals assigned.
  • Data collection – goals, protocols, outings, SUB's, progress notes, recreation/fitness logs.
  • Obtain and maintain certification for, and administer medications under the supervision of assigned nursing staff (AMAP), if applicable.
  • Fulfill responsibilities of primary advocate (paperwork, advocacy, programming).
  • Instruction and documentation, participation in development and revisions of formal goals and protocols in accordance with the CFA/ISP, and behavior plans.
  • Teach and assist individuals in all aspects of daily living, including ADL's, cooking, house cleaning, laundry, leading a healthy lifestyle, shopping, budgeting, maintaining appropriate behavior, and community integration.
  • Accompany individuals on medical appointments, jobs, and community activities, if applicable.
  • Complete incident reports and SCIP-R reports as necessary.
  • Knowledge and accurate implementation of Emergency Procedures.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of all OPWDD and DDI policy and procedures as they pertain to individuals supported, and documentation of such.
  • Ensure the vans are clean and vehicle problems are written down and addressed through the Site Supervisor/Manager.
